Meet Larissa Paut
Lab Manager- The Smile LabArtistry, Precision, and Passion Behind Every Smile
Larissa Paut is more than a Lab Manager—she’s the creative engine driving The Smile Lab’s ability to deliver beautifully crafted, life-changing restorations. With over four years in dentistry and a personal journey that began by overcoming her own dental fears, Larissa blends empathy, innovation, and leadership into every project she touches.
From full-arch design to cosmetic detail work, Larissa sees each restoration as both a technical challenge and a human opportunity. Her goal? To help patients feel confident, valued, and transformed.
Education & Certifications
- Registered Dental Assistant (RDA)
- American Academy of Cosmetic Aesthetics (AACA)
- OSHA & CPR Certified
Areas of Expertise
- Dental laboratory team management
- Restorative case collaboration with doctors
- Aesthetic layering and smile design
- Chairside-lab case troubleshooting and support
- Workflow and communication systems across locations
